| Description | Acyclovir sodium is a guanosine nucleoside analogue and viral DNA polymerase inhibitor with antiviral activity, used to treat skin and mucous membrane HSV infections, exhibiting significant activity against HSV-1, HSV-2, and VZV. |
| Targets&IC50 | HSV2:0.86 μM, HSV1:0.85 μM |
| In vitro | Jurkat, U937, and K562 leukemia cells were treated with Acyclovir sodium (3-100 μM, 24-72 hours) to measure cell viability. Results: Acyclovir sodium reduced cell viability in a dose- and time-dependent manner. [1] |
| Synonyms | Acycloguanosine sodium, Aciclovir sodium |
| Molecular Weight | 247.19 |
| Formula | C8H10N5NaO3 |
| Cas No. | 69657-51-8 |
| Smiles | O=C1N=C(NC2=C1N=CN2COCC[O-])N.[Na+] |
